Traveler Guide to Pascagoula, MS

Pascagoula is on the Gulf Coast of Mississippi, on the east side of the Pascagoula River. Besides beaches, it is the site of considerable industry with the Ingalls Shipbuilding Company and other operations. Hurricane Katrina's forces were so strong here in 2005 that they even damaged US Navy ships. Jimmy Buffett and Channing Tatum spent at least part of their childhood here.

1 Old Spanish Fort (La Pointe Krebs Museum), 4602 Fort St, ☏ +1 228 471-5126. M-Sa 10AM-5PM, Su Noon-5PM. Said to be the oldest structure in the Mississippi Valley, built in the 1750s.
